Suppose the market for grass seed is expressed as:
Demand: QD = 100 - 2p
Supply: QS = 3p
Price elasticity of supply is constant at 1.If the supply curve is changed to Q = 8p,price elasticity of supply is still constant at one.Yet with the new supply curve,consumers pay a larger share of a specific tax.Why?


Definitions:

Elastic Demand

A situation in which the demand for a product or service significantly changes in response to changes in price.

Quantity Demanded

The total amount of a good or service that consumers are willing and able to purchase at a specific price point.

Percentage Increase

A measure of how much a quantity has grown compared to its original number, expressed as a percentage.

Demand Curve

The demand curve is a graphical representation showing the relationship between the quantity of a good consumers are willing to buy and its price.
